What is a Work Injury Compensation Lawyer?
A work injury compensation lawyer is a legal professional specializing in helping employees who have sustained injuries or diseases due to their tasks. They help customers with navigating employees' compensation claims, negotiating settlements, and representing them in court if needed.

When a worker suffers a work-related injury, taking the best steps is important for protecting compensation. Here's a list of instant actions to consider:

Seek Medical Attention: Prioritize your health and security. Get a medical evaluation and treatment for your injuries.

Report the Injury: Notify your employer about the incident immediately. It's necessary to record the injury according to business policy.

File Everything: Keep records of all medical treatments, discussions with employers and insurance companies, and any other appropriate documentation.

Frequently Asked Questions1. What kinds of injuries are covered by workers' compensation?
Employees' compensation typically covers a broad variety of injuries, including physical injuries (damaged bones, sprains), occupational illness (respiratory issues from breathing in harmful compounds), and psychological conditions (stress and anxiety or depression due to [Workplace Injury Lawyer](https://fkwiki.win/wiki/Post:15_UpAndComing_Trends_About_Accident_Injury_Compensation) events).
2. How long do I need to file a workers' compensation claim?
The time limitation, known as the statute of restrictions, varies from state to state. Usually, employees need to sue within a few weeks to a few years after the injury occurs.
3. Can I sue my company for a work-related injury?
Most of the times, workers' compensation is the sole solution for work-related injuries, which implies you normally can not sue your employer. Nevertheless, exceptions exist, such as if your employer was grossly irresponsible.
4. What should I do if my claim is rejected?
If a claim is rejected, employees can appeal the choice. Consulting with a work injury compensation lawyer during this process is vital for navigating the appeals.
5. How much does it cost to work with a work injury compensation lawyer?
The majority of work injury compensation attorneys work on a contingency cost basis, indicating they only get paid if you get a settlement. The percentage will differ however is normally around 15%-30%.
